A Short Story - Destiny
This is my 2nd attempt to write a short story. First one was way back in 2007. Comments and Critics are welcome.
Destiny
He was hungry. He can't feel his legs at all. The prey was just before him. Teasing him. The smell felt good. But, he was a vegetarian. I can't eat anything other than vegetarian, he thought. But, the hunger was killing him. He saw his lover had no trouble eating non-vegetarian. How could she do that? Boy, he hated her for doing so. But, the bell inside his stomach kept on ringing. With one last hope, he searched for anything that's vegetarian. A fruit or a flower – goddamn it show me at least a leaf! Looked like God had no mercy on him. With trembling hands and awful feeling, he decided to eat the prey at last. He did not know how to even eat that non-vegetarian. He asked his lover. Simple, go there, eat and then come back – said she. Felt easy. He was a little bit relieved. He raised his chest up, cursed whoever made all the trees disappear and went near the prey. He started with a bit of hesitance as he did not know if the prey was dead or even alive. As he started eating, the blood, rushed through his mouth, something crushed him along with the prey leaving his body stick with the prey. Rest In Peace Mosquito.
PS 1: Do you know that only Female mosquitoes bite us? Male Mosquitoes are vegetarian.
